Two Lansing schools were briefly locked down due to a report of an armed robbery.
Lansing Police say a 37-year-old woman was robbed on the 5400 block of South Cedar Street by two teenage boys, one of whom had a gun.
It happened at 8:44 a.m.
The two took money, but did not harm the woman.
Gardner Middle School and North Elementary were briefly locked down while police searched the area for the suspects.
They have not been found, but the schools have resumed normal security procedures.
